Chinese ideograms
- Top to bottom:
常平 = Sang pyong, a Department of Korean Yi Dynasty
- Right to left:
通寶 = Tong bo, means currency
Lettering:
常
寶 通
平
Mint mark at top, denomination right to left
*忠 (Chung): Chungchong Provincial Office
Lettering:
忠
十 當
Translation: Chungchong Provincial Office, Value 10
忠 | Ch'ungch'ong Provincial Office (忠清監營 (Ch'ungch'ong Kamyong)), modern-day Gongju, South Korea (1742-1884) |
